there is no prior information about the proportion of americans who support gun control in 2018. if we want to estimate 95% confidence interval for the true proportion of americans who support gun control in 2018 with a 0.36 margin of error, how many randomly selected americans must be surveyed? answer: (round up your answer to nearest whole number)
Answer:
Step-by-step explanation:
To estimate the required sample size for estimating the true proportion of Americans who support gun control in 2018 with a 95% confidence level and a margin of error of 0.36, we need to use the formula:
n = (Z^2 * p * (1 - p)) / E^2
Where:
n = required sample size
Z = Z-score corresponding to the desired confidence level (for 95% confidence level, Z ≈ 1.96)
p = estimated proportion (since we have no prior information, we can use p = 0.5, which gives the maximum sample size required)
E = margin of error
Substituting the values into the formula:
n = (1.96^2 * 0.5 * (1 - 0.5)) / 0.36^2
n = (3.8416 * 0.25) / 0.1296
n ≈ 9.6042 / 0.1296
n ≈ 74.0842
Rounding up to the nearest whole number, the required sample size is approximately 75. Therefore, you would need to survey at least 75 randomly selected Americans to estimate the true proportion of Americans who support gun control in 2018 with a 95% confidence level and a margin of error of 0.36.

Boaz went on holiday by aeroplane. The flight time was 6 hours 24 minutes.
The average speed of the aeroplane was 620 kilometres per hour.
Work out the distance the aeroplane flew to the nearest Km.
Answer: 3968km
Step-by-step explanation:
1. Convert 6 hours 24 minutes into hours. 24 minutes in hours is 24/60=0.4. So 6.4 hours.
2. 620km/h so multiply 620 by 6.4 = 3968km.

A ranger at the top of a fire tower observes the angle of depression to a fire on level ground to be 6.0°. If the tower is 260 ft tall, what is the ground distance from the base of the tower to the fire? (Round your answer to 3 significant digits.)
To find the ground distance from the base of the tower to the fire, we can use trigonometry and the angle of depression. Let's denote the ground distance as "d."
We have a right triangle formed by the height of the tower (260 ft), the ground distance (d), and the angle of depression (6.0°). The height of the tower is the opposite side of the right angle, and the ground distance is the adjacent side.
Using the trigonometric ratio for tangent (tan), we can set up the following equation:
tan(6.0°) = opposite/adjacent
tan(6.0°) = 260/d
Now, we can solve for "d" by rearranging the equation:
d = 260 / tan(6.0°)
Using a calculator, we find that tan(6.0°) is approximately 0.1051. Therefore: d = 260 / 0.1051 ≈ 2473.102 ft
Rounding to three significant digits, the ground distance from the base of the tower to the fire is approximately 2473 ft.

The most common purpose for Pearson correlational is to examine
For Pearson correlation the most common purpose to examine is given by option a. The relationship between 2 variables.
The Pearson correlation is a statistical measure that indicates the extent to which two continuous variables are linearly related.
It measures the strength and direction of the relationship between two variables.
Ranging from -1 perfect negative correlation to 1 perfect positive correlation.
And with 0 indicating no correlation.
It is commonly used in research to examine the association between two variables.
Such as the relationship between height and weight, or between income and education level.
Therefore, the most common purpose of a Pearson correlation is to examine the relationship between 2 variables.
